A conversation with former fighter pilot and business leader Gary Borland. Gary left school at 18 to become a flight engineer. He rose through the ranks of the RAF to ultimately become the Chief Test Pilot at UK Ministry of Defence. Gary's second act was to become a senior business leader in the aviation sector. Gary shares his journey to the pinnacle of a flying career, plus the shifts he had to make in himself to become an effective business leader. A conversation with Tom Druitt, founder of the Big Lemon. Big Lemon aims to be the first operator to run the only fully-electric bus fleet in the UK and is well on the way to fulfilling that mission.
